The Illusion of Control

Many new traders enter the crypto space believing they can “beat the market.” They spend hours analyzing charts, studying indicators, and seeking the perfect entry point. While research is vital, this pursuit often stems from a deep-seated need for control. We *want* to believe we can predict the future, especially when our money is on the line. Crypto, however, relentlessly demonstrates the limits of prediction. Unexpected news events, regulatory changes, and even social media sentiment can trigger rapid price swings, rendering even the most sophisticated analysis obsolete.

This illusion of control leads to several detrimental behaviors. Traders might overtrade, constantly chasing small gains, or stubbornly hold onto losing positions, hoping for a reversal that never comes. Recognizing that uncertainty is *fundamental* to crypto trading is the first step towards emotional resilience. It’s not about eliminating risk – it’s about managing it effectively, knowing you can’t eliminate uncertainty.

Common Psychological Pitfalls

Let's examine some of the most common psychological traps that ensnare crypto traders:

  • Fear of Missing Out (FOMO):* This is perhaps the most pervasive emotion in crypto, fueled by the rapid price appreciation of certain assets. Seeing others profit can trigger intense anxiety and lead to impulsive decisions. Traders buy at the top, driven by the fear of being left behind, only to experience significant losses when the market corrects.
  • Panic Selling:* The flip side of FOMO. When prices plummet, fear takes over, and traders rush to sell, often locking in losses. This is particularly acute in the futures market, where liquidation risks are amplified.
  • Confirmation Bias:* The tendency to seek out information that confirms pre-existing beliefs while ignoring contradictory evidence. A trader who believes Solana (SOL) will rise might only read positive news articles, dismissing warnings about potential downsides.
  • Loss Aversion:* The pain of a loss is psychologically more powerful than the pleasure of an equivalent gain. This can lead to irrational behavior, such as holding onto losing trades for too long in the hope of breaking even.   • Overconfidence Bias:* After a few successful trades, traders may become overconfident in their abilities, taking on excessive risk and ignoring sound risk management principles.
  • Anchoring Bias:* Fixating on a previous price point, even if it’s irrelevant to the current market conditions. For example, refusing to sell a cryptocurrency below its all-time high, even though the market is clearly trending downwards.

Strategies for Maintaining Discipline

Here are practical strategies to cultivate discipline and mitigate the psychological pitfalls of crypto trading:

  • Develop a Trading Plan:* This is the foundation of disciplined trading. Your plan should outline your trading goals, risk tolerance, entry and exit rules, position sizing, and money management strategies. A well-defined plan removes emotional guesswork and provides a framework for making rational decisions. Consider using resources on Developing Trading Strategies to refine your approach.
  • Risk Management is Paramount:* Never risk more than a small percentage of your capital on any single trade (e.g., 1-2%). Use stop-loss orders to limit potential losses. Diversify your portfolio to reduce exposure to any single asset. Understanding leverage is critical – use it cautiously and responsibly.
  • Accept Losses as Part of the Process:* Losses are inevitable in trading. Don’t beat yourself up over them. Instead, analyze what went wrong, learn from your mistakes, and move on. Focus on the long-term profitability of your strategy, not individual trades.   • Limit Exposure to Market Noise:* Constant exposure to price charts, news feeds, and social media chatter can fuel anxiety and impulsive behavior. Set specific times to check your portfolio and avoid obsessively monitoring the markets.
  • Practice Mindfulness and Emotional Regulation:* Techniques like meditation, deep breathing exercises, and journaling can help you manage stress and emotional reactivity. Recognize your emotional triggers and develop strategies for responding to them in a rational manner.
  • Keep a Trading Journal:* Record your trades, including your rationale, emotions, and results. This will help you identify patterns in your behavior and learn from your mistakes.
  • Start Small:* Begin with a small amount of capital that you can afford to lose. This will reduce the psychological pressure and allow you to practice your trading plan without risking significant funds.

Real-World Scenarios

Let's illustrate these principles with some scenarios:

  • Scenario 1: The Solana Pump (Spot Trading):* SOL suddenly surges in price. FOMO kicks in, and you're tempted to buy at the peak. *Instead:* Refer to your trading plan. If SOL isn't part of your pre-defined investment strategy, resist the urge to chase the price. If it is, ensure your entry point aligns with your plan’s criteria.
  • Scenario 2: The Unexpected News Event (Futures Trading):* Negative news about Solana emerges, causing a rapid price drop. Your futures position is in danger of liquidation. *Instead:* Don't panic sell. Review your stop-loss order. If it’s appropriately placed, allow it to execute. Accept the loss as part of the process and avoid making impulsive decisions.
  • Scenario 3: The Winning Trade (Spot Trading):* You bought SOL at $20, and it’s now trading at $50. You’re tempted to hold on for even higher gains. *Instead:* Review your profit-taking rules. If the price has reached your target, take profits and lock in your gains. Don't let greed cloud your judgment.
  • Scenario 4: The Losing Trade (Futures Trading):* You entered a long position on SOL futures, expecting an uptrend, but the price falls. *Instead:* Accept that your analysis was incorrect. Don’t average down (add to your losing position). Respect your stop-loss order and cut your losses.
